Ir para conteúdo
Fórum Script Brasil
  • 0

Página Aspx Não Está Reconhecendo Css.


Guest ---s_ric_ptbrasil ---

Pergunta

Guest ---s_ric_ptbrasil ---

Página aspx não está reconhecendo CSS.

Eu tenho uma página Cabecalho Master que está com a tal CSS linkada.

As páginas aspx que fazem parte da pagina Master, não estão aparecendo o estilo da tal CSS, por quê ?

Por favor, me ajudem. Agradeço desde já pelo meu pedido.

No código da página master a css se encontra da seguinte forma:

<head runat="server">
    <title>Untitled Page</title>
    <script language="javascript" src="../js/Funcoes.js"></script>
    [b]<link rel='stylesheet' type='text/css' [color="#FF0000"]href='../css/Class.css'[/color] />[/b]
</head>

Link para o comentário
Compartilhar em outros sites

14 respostass a esta questão

Posts Recomendados

  • 0
Guest ---s_ric_ptbrasil ---

Na verdade é só uma página aspx que tem a tal css relacionada.

Exemplo:

Class.css (dentro dela tem vários estilos, uma delas é estilo de link do tipo "a.link1:{...} a.link2:{...} a.link3:{...}") .

Na página aspx tem uma label (Filtro) que está relacionada ao estilo "link1". Exemplo

<TABLE id="TabFiltro" width="96%" align="center" runat="server">
      <TBODY>
              <TR>
                    <TD>
                            <asp:Label id="lblFiltro" runat="server" CssClass="linkum"> ...
...
...
</Table>

Enfim, já fiz de tudo e nada: Analisei a class.css para ver se está certo, olhei no código da página aspx para ver se estava relacionada, olhei na página Master para ver se estava a class.css linkada e ainda fiz o ftp dos arquivos e não adiantou.

O que deve ser . Por favor me dêem um help. Agradeço desde já.

Link para o comentário
Compartilhar em outros sites

  • 0

duas coisas:

<asp:Label id="lblFiltro" runat="server" CssClass="linkum">
o nome da classe ta linkum mas você disse q no css ta a.link1, você ta pondo nomes q batam mesmo?? outra coisa, se você ciruou a classe com nome a.link1 a classe so vale pra tag a e o asp:Label, quando você abrir a pagina, vira um span por isso essa classe não vai funcionar pra ele. se você criar só assim:
.link1 {
    propriedade1: valor1;
    propriedade2: valor2;
}[/code]

ai sim deve funcionar.

Link para o comentário
Compartilhar em outros sites

  • 0
Guest --- s_ric_ptbrasil ---

1º. O nome da class está correto eu coloquei link1 só como exemplo.

2º. Eu testei como você falou, mas mesmo assim eu não entendi. O código é para inserir aonde? É dentro da class ou dentro da label?

Link para o comentário
Compartilhar em outros sites

  • 0

quis dizer, aqui ó, você disse q seus codigos tavam tipo assim:

a.link1:{...} a.link2:{...} a.link3:{...}
quis dizer pra você fazer assim:
.link1:{...} .link2:{...} .link3:{...}
se você fizer a.link1 essa classe só vai funciona pra tag a (link). o asp:Label é uma tag span por isso não funciona com o a.link1 na hora de preencher a classe do asp:Label, pode dexar como esta:
<asp:Label id="lblFiltro" runat="server" CssClass="link1">

Link para o comentário
Compartilhar em outros sites

  • 0
Guest --- s_ric_ptbrasil ---

o css não está na class.css, está na própria página:

<style type="text/css">
<!--
/* PARA O LINK 1 */
.link1:link {
color:#FF0000;
text-decoration:none;
}
.link1:visited {
color:#00ff00;
text-decoration:none;
}
.link1:hover {
color:#0000ff;
text-decoration:none;
}
.link1:active {
color:#ffFF00;
text-decoration:none;
background-color:#000000;
}

-->
</style>
e a página aspx:
<TABLE id="TabFiltro" cellSpacing="0" cellPadding="6" width="96%" align="center" bgColor="#eeeeee" border="0" runat="server">
    <TBODY>
    <TR>
    <TD>
    <P align="center">
    <asp:Label id="lblFiltro" runat="server" CssClass="link1">
    </asp:Label>
    </P>
    </TD>
    </TR>
    </TBODY>
    </TABLE>

Link para o comentário
Compartilhar em outros sites

  • 0

deve estar funcionando sim (desde q tenha conteudo no label).

aparentemente não vai acontecer nd. porque você não pos formato pra classe em si mas só pra quando tiver um link nela (veja q você fez .link1:link).

mas se você passar o mouse por cima do seu label ele deve mudar para o formato q ta no hover, não??

e se você clicar ele vai tb vai mudar pro fotmato q ta no active.

so os formatos do link e do visited q você não vai ver, a não ser q ponha uma tag <a> dentro do label.

tenta passar o mouse por cima e clicar no conteudo do seu label pra ver se ele não muda.

Link para o comentário
Compartilhar em outros sites

  • 0
Guest --- s_ric_ptbrasil ---

Eu fiz assim.

<TABLE id="TabFiltro" cellSpacing="0" cellPadding="6" width="96%" align="center" bgColor="#eeeeee" border="0" runat="server">

<TBODY>

<TR>

<TD>

<P align="center"><a class="link1">

<asp:Label id="lblFiltro" runat="server">

</asp:Label></a>

</P>

</TD>

</TR>

</TBODY>

</TABLE>

Eu estou errado?Não funcionou.

Link para o comentário
Compartilhar em outros sites

Participe da discussão

Você pode postar agora e se registrar depois. Se você já tem uma conta, acesse agora para postar com sua conta.

Visitante
Responder esta pergunta...

×   Você colou conteúdo com formatação.   Remover formatação

  Apenas 75 emoticons são permitidos.

×   Seu link foi incorporado automaticamente.   Exibir como um link em vez disso

×   Seu conteúdo anterior foi restaurado.   Limpar Editor

×   Você não pode colar imagens diretamente. Carregar ou inserir imagens do URL.



  • Estatísticas dos Fóruns

    • Tópicos
      152,3k
    • Posts
      652,4k
×
×
  • Criar Novo...